Product reviews:
Muppet Show 60cm Kermit frog Puppets kermit the frog puppet in stores
kermit the frog puppet in stores
Patrick
2024-11-15 iphone X
Angus Puppets Master Replicas kermit the frog puppet in stores
kermit the frog puppet in stores
Jerome
2024-11-20 iphone 8
Muppet Show Large 60cm Kermit frog kermit the frog puppet in stores
kermit the frog puppet in stores